This four bedroom semi-detached house has been well cared for and enjoys a private position in a pleasant cul-de-sac situated just off Hills Road via Red Cross Lane. The property is gas-central heated and double-glazed throughout, and has a well-tended private garden backing onto well-tended communal gardens of Cedar Court.
The accommodation briefly comprises an entrance hall with a personal door to the integral garage and access to a cloakroom W.C. The kitchen has been fitted with a range of base and wall-mounted units; integrated appliances include an oven and four-ring gas hob with an extractor over. Completing the ground floor accommodation is a generous living/dining room with double doors to the rear garden, finished with attractive parquet flooring, which continues through to the main entrance hall.
Upstairs are four good sized bedrooms and a main bathroom, fitted with a modern white suite including a shower over the bath and complemented by a heated towel rail.
Outside, there is a driveway parking and access to the single garage with up-and-over door. A side entrance leads to the private rear garden which has a patio, well suited to alfresco dining. The remainder is laid to lawn and bordered with a variety of mature shrubs, plants and trees.
Agent's Note - Before their purchase in 2009, our vendors were made aware of historical issues with possible subsidence to the property. They commissioned a Structural Engineers report, which can be provided to any prospective buyers upon request.
Location - Stansgate Avenue is a select development of just 33 dwellings, built in 1968 and enjoying an ideal location, close to local amenities, the Cambridge City Centre, and a few minutes’ walk from the highly acclaimed Cambridge Universities Hospitals site at Addenbrookes, including the Biomedical Campus.
There are excellent transport networks to the rest of the city including cycle routes and multiple frequent bus services to the city centre and railway station.
Cambridge Railway Station is just 1.3 miles from the property with direct services to London, Birmingham and Peterborough. The property is situated just over 2 miles south of the city centre with its combination of ancient and modern buildings, winding lanes, excellent choice of schools and wide range of shopping facilities.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
